actionkit模板允许您在本地查看actionkit模板,测试每种页面类型的不同配置。它还通过代码记录每个页面的许多上下文变量

actionkit-templates的Python项目详细描述


actionkit模板呈现器
==
==

这是什么

如果您使用[actionkit](http://actionkit.com/)并编辑其模板,那么您可能希望在本地看到它们的样子。如果您安装了这个(`pip install actionkit templates`),那么您可以运行


然后您可以从本地端口查看它们。这将在actionkit
自身运行的类似环境中运行django。




因此,事情可能会在不同版本之间发生变化——可能会限制完整的django
manage.py上下文,而是通过命令行公开这些事情。同时,您可以
查看“actionkit\u templates/settings.py”并搜索“os.environ”以了解其功能。

template\u dir
:默认情况下,我们搜索本地目录和名为template\u set的目录。如果运行:

template dir=actionkittemplates aktemplates runserver

devenv.enabled或page.custom_fields.layout_options%}
<;中的“devdevdevdev”!--在本地开发样式表-->;
<;link href=“/static/stylesheets/site.css”rel=“stylesheet”/>;
{%else%}
<;!--样式表的生产位置-->;
<;link href=“https://example.com/static/stylesheets/site.css”rel=“stylesheet”/>;
{%endif%}
```

static_fallback
:在没有Internet连接的情况下开发时,有时会无法加载:

````
{%load_js%}
///ajax.googleapis.com/ajax/libs/jquery/1.9.1/jquery.min.js
{%end%}
```

如果将static_fallback设置为存在“jquery.min.js”
的目录,然后它将查找该目录中的所有Internet外部文件。
请注意,这仅适用于“加载js”和“加载css”模板标记。




当遇到未涵盖的内容时,会有助于
==


这里很容易添加“actionkit_templates/templatetags/actionkit_tags.py`
我们应该致力于支持所有这些:
https://roboticdogs.actionkit.com/docs/manual/guide/customtags.html

extra context s
----

请提供
`actionkit_templates/contexts/`的补丁,注意这些对浏览器也很有用,可以查看
您可以从特定页面上下文访问哪些变量。

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
IntelliJ中的java默认Maven项目结构不一致   java我希望链接(在帖子和页面上)在一些访问者加载时被自动点击   java如何使用单独的方法隐藏JButton并在新类中调用   java KStream leftJoin KStream具有相同的密钥   java图像在垂直滚动窗格视图端口中消失   java从指定的起始点开始以n的增量填充数组   java JLabel和JTextField不在swing表单中应用   java springboot mongo如果没有映像,请使用现有映像   类似C++映射的java容器   java如何在没有Valgrind错误的情况下调用JNI_CreateJavaVM?   java如何在安卓中运行后台服务   java onPostExecute不运行